Curis is a free web-based structured breathing exercise tool focused on modes such as Box Breathing, Triangle, Inverted Triangle, Simple, and Walking. The page highlights that these methods are used by Navy SEALs, athletes, and meditation practitioners for scenarios such as stress reduction, improved focus, and better sleep. Strictly speaking, it is not a typical AI application: the main content does not mention models, generative AI, intelligent recommendations, or automated personalized training capabilities.
The tool offers a large number of breathing presets, such as Box Navy SEAL 4-4-4-4, Sleep Prep, Anxiety Ease, Morning Energy, and Focus Flow. It also allows users to customize the duration of inhaling, holding, exhaling, and resting. In terms of interaction, it includes a breathing circle animation, progress bar, phase prompts, text guidance, audio cues, mobile haptic feedback, full-screen mode, dark mode, and keyboard shortcuts. It also records total practice time and today’s session count, and supports setting a target number of minutes.
The main text clearly states Free, No accounts, no data collection, and no tracking, with no mention of subscriptions, paid versions, or trial limitations. In terms of privacy, the page says all data is stored only on the local device through browser localStorage and will not be collected, transmitted, or stored on external servers. The page also includes an advertising inquiry entry point, indicating that it may monetize through ad placements.
Its advantages are that it is easy to get started with, requires no registration, and offers a very rich set of presets, making it suitable for everyday stress relief and pre-sleep practice. Its privacy statement is also fairly user-friendly. The drawbacks are the lack of Chinese interface information, no API or integration capabilities, and no AI-powered personalized feedback. Although its health benefits are supported by references, the page also clearly states that it is for wellness purposes only and cannot replace professional medical advice.
Curis is suitable for individual users who want to quickly do breathing training, meditation support, anxiety relief, pre-sleep relaxation, or CPAP breathing practice. It is not suitable for users looking for an AI health coach, medical-grade monitoring, or enterprise integrations.
